Meaning and Origin

The origins of Keighley are shrouded in some mystery. It is believed to be rooted in the British market town of the same name, with possible origins in the Old English phrase "Cyhha's clearing." However, another interpretation suggests Keighley might have originated from the Irish word "caoladh," meaning "slender," through the Anglicized name Caley. This interpretation gives the name a more tangible meaning, connecting it to grace and delicacy.

Pronunciation and Spelling

Keighley is generally pronounced "KAY-lee," with the emphasis on the first syllable. The spelling can be a bit tricky, with some people mistakenly adding an extra "i" or mispronouncing the "gh." This might lead to some initial confusion but ultimately adds to the name's uniqueness.

Nickname Choices

Keighley lends itself to several charming nicknames. "Kay" is a popular and easy-to-use choice, while "Kei" or "Leigh" provide more unique options.

Variation and Similar Names

Variations of the name include "Keighly," "Keighla," and "Keiley." Similar-sounding names include "Knightley" and "Oakley." Names with similar meanings include "Blakelie," "Harlee," and "Prime."
